I would like to have a particular image appear in two different galleries (which reside in different categories/sub-categories) without having to upload the same image twice...Is this possible? If so, how would I go about doing this?

The only way to do it without uploading twice is to duplicate the image in your first gallery and then move the duplicate to the second gallery. Choose Make 2nd Copy, then choose move photos.
